如何inline code在Confluence中格式化like this?我的意思是,不是单独的代码块,而是内联classname,例如.
我需要使用rest api在confluence中创建新的wiki页面的工作示例.我更喜欢在特定空间和特定页面下创建新页面.我阅读了他们的api文档,看了几个他们的例子,但仍然很短.
以下是他们在网站上的示例
curl -u admin:admin -X POST -H 'Content-Type: application/json' -d'{"type":"page","title":"new page","space":{"key":"TST"},"body":{"storage":{"value":"<p>This is a new page</p>","representation":"storage"}}}' http://localhost:8080/confluence/rest/api/content/ | python -mjson.tool
Run Code Online (Sandbox Code Playgroud)
我尝试使用我的空间名称,新标题并将URL更改为mysite/rest/api/content并返回内容基本上是html页面,说页面不存在或页面存在但您没有权限.我已经确认我可以访问confluence wiki并可以使用我的凭据创建新的wiki.
还不清楚的是,在上面的示例中,如何调用创建页面的特定api?它没有任何意义.
在他们的论坛上提出了类似的问题,但没有合理的答案 https://answers.atlassian.com/questions/149561/simple-confluence-rest-api-usage-what-am-i-missing
(我想我的最终目标是能够自动在汇合处创建新的wiki页面.如果有必要的话,我可以放弃汇总REST API到其他解决方案.
请告诉我你使用的JIRA /汇合程序是什么类型的程序.我不喜欢jira因为Java风格的设计.例如,我喜欢PivotalTracker来跟踪新项目.
你有什么建议?谢谢!
我们使用confluence进行文档编制,但我发现选择代码宏非常耗时; 这是一个5步骤的过程.即使手动输入宏也不高效.
在Stack Overflow编辑器中,我们所要做的就是选择文本并按下按钮或点击ctrlK,文本格式化为代码.
有没有办法在Confluence中做到这一点?
是否可以将Confluence xml转储导入Mediawiki?如果是这样,任何指导将不胜感激.
谢谢你的帮助!
Mylyn Wikitext的API文档具有将Wiki Markup转换为HTML的功能,但我找不到将HTML代码转换/解析为Wiki Markup的功能.类MarkupParser有方法parseToHTML,但在哪里可以找到相反的方法?
很高兴在Confluence中拥有版本历史记录.但是,每次编辑和保存文档时都会创建新版本.我正在寻找更多的"发布"历史.假设我的文档/页面版本为1.0.然后,在我准备好"发布"1.1之前,我编辑并保存了几次页面.我需要一些东西将版本链接到版本号,然后有一个自动发布历史记录.
有没有办法在Confluence做类似的事情?
我根据Atlassian提供的基本/中级/高级教程创建了一个Confluence蓝图插件.我现在想要更新页面模板以包含{HTML}具有嵌入式CDATA 的宏,其中该CDATA中的URL包含要用用户输入的数据替换的部分.
我理想地喜欢做什么,<at:var...>被替换为locationid:
<ac:structured-macro ac:name="html">
<ac:plain-text-body>
<![CDATA[<iframe src="http://...?locationid=<at:var at:name="locationid"/>"></iframe>]]>
</ac:plain-text-body>
</ac:structured-macro>
Run Code Online (Sandbox Code Playgroud)
不幸的是,这不起作用; 的<at:var at:name="...">内部CDATA不能被取代.
我已经尝试了各种格式,例如替换整个CDATA字符串本身,甚至可以<ac:structured-macro>在单个字符串中替换整个块.没有工作.
谷歌搜索带来了对Atlassian的社区维基两个非常相似的问题,这个和这个.此外,我找到了一个Confluence Server JIRA来解决这个问题,但它被拒绝并关闭了.
尽管存在反对解决方案的证据,但我希望某位创意人员知道如何实现这一目标?
Atlassian SDK: 6.2.14
我需要从WIKI标记页面获取我正在读取的数据并将其存储为表结构.我试图找出如何正确解析下面的标记语法到C#中的一些表数据结构
这是一个示例表:
|| Owner || Action || Status || Comments ||
| Bill | Fix the lobby | In Progress | This is easy |
| Joe | Fix the bathroom | In Progress | Plumbing \\
\\
Electric \\
\\
Painting \\
\\
\\ |
| Scott | Fix the roof | Complete | This is expensive |
Run Code Online (Sandbox Code Playgroud)
以下是它的直接来源:
|| Owner|| Action || Status || Comments || | Bill\\ | fix the lobby |In Progress | This is eary| …Run Code Online (Sandbox Code Playgroud) 我已成功使用Confluence Rest API创建页面并将其附加到Space.我的json看起来很像这个例子:
{
"type":"page","title":"My Example Page 1", "space": {"key":"DAT"},
"body":{"storage":{"value":"<p>This is a new page</p>","representation":"storage"}}
}
Run Code Online (Sandbox Code Playgroud)
如果我在Confluence中以交互方式创建页面,当我单击"附件"或"活动流"之类的"编辑"按钮时,我会获得一个固定宏列表.
使用附件宏作为正文而不是"这是一个新页面"来创建页面的正确json值是什么?
像下面的东西(完全组成):
{
"type":"page","title":"My Example Page 1", "space": {"key":"DAT"},
"body":{"storage":{"value":"**Attachments_Macro_Block**","representation":"storage"}}
}
Run Code Online (Sandbox Code Playgroud)
我会用什么代替json中的'Attachments_Macro_Block'来获得显示宏块的结果页面?
confluence ×10
c# ×1
html ×1
java ×1
jira ×1
json ×1
mediawiki ×1
mylyn ×1
porting ×1
rest ×1
sample ×1
versioning ×1
wiki ×1
wiki-markup ×1
xml ×1